Output d066dafb14eff5356996818e888526143339c7e915549a2edbd9a3ba5562bc72:16

value
304844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 050277d865ed32d429f37f294174a69f25cd4452 OP_EQUAL
address
329WFzXctmmngRPB8mGkkfNEKGSHGxrNck
transaction
d066dafb14eff5356996818e888526143339c7e915549a2edbd9a3ba5562bc72
spent
true